For the square root of 25, your test offers the best reply, but for different values, it offers incorrect output. If you test this method with the square root of 25 every time, your unit tests can miss this error and the outcomes can be biased. The perfect technique of testing is to choose a number at random, sq. it, then test your operate utilizing the squared value as input and see whether it returns the same worth. False positives can lead to a “cry wolf” situation in which developers who have acquired a lot of false alarms start to ignore check results entirely and, due to this fact, ignore actual issues. On high of that, the effort to track down these bugs that don’t actually exist may cause project delays, resulting in lacking deadlines and extra prices. Flaky checks are checks that cross or fail inconsistently, even when no modifications have been made to the codebase. These tests are a standard cause of false failure false positives as a outcome of they’ll report failures intermittently.
If your check environment is unstable, it’d lead to incorrect and inconsistent test results, which may lead to each false negatives and positives. When we are saying unstable take a look at surroundings, we imply environmental issues such as network latency, incorrect configuration, and so forth, which may all have an effect on the test’s accuracy.
